1.1 ABOUT BOSCH

History of Bosch

In 1886, Robert Bosch founded the "Workshop for Precision Mechanics and Electrical Engineering" in

Stuttgart. This was the birth of today's globally active Robert Bosch GmbH. From the very

beginning, the company's history has been characterized by innovative drive and social

commitment. In 1928, Bosch founded its Power Tool Division (PT).

Today Bosch is proud to be the market leader in our industry and we will be honored to celebrate in

2011 the 125th Anniversary of our company. In 2008, the 80th Anniversary of Bosch Power Tools was

celebrated worldwide. Unlike the 80th anniversary where it was all about PT, the 125 years also

aims at presenting our company values and philosophy.

1.2 BACKGROUNDER ON BOSCH POWER TOOLS ASIA CORDLESS RACE 2011

Bosch Power Tools Asia Cordless Race 2011

In conjunction with Bosch’s 125 anniversary in 2011, Bosch Power Tools is taking the opportunity to

celebrate with a Bosch Power Tools Asia Cordless Race 2011. Participating countries are: China,

Thailand, Phillipines, South Korea and Malaysia.

Open to students from any Malaysian university and/ or technical institutions, the championship

will challenge students to design a blueprint for a racing kart powered entirely by 4 Bosch GSB 18V-

Li Professional cordless drills / drivers.

Eight teams will then be shortlisted, whereby each team will receive an allowance of RM12,000 to

build karts based on their blueprint submission. The finalists will then race their Cordless Karts at

the Open Car Park Space on Jalan Binjai, near KLCC on 30 July 2011.

The winner of the race will represent Malaysia at the Grand Finals in Beijing, China and stand a

chance to win some amazing prizes.

3.2 GENERAL GUIDELINES FOR CAR DESIGN & COMPETITION

1. General Conditions

The task shall be to design and submit a blueprint for a “Li-Ion Vehicle” powered by 4 BOSCH

GSB 18V-LI Professional cordless impact drills / drivers (“the power tools”) by 5.30pm, 13 May

2011.

The top eight entries will then be shortlisted with each team receiving an allowance of

RM12,000 to fabricate karts based on their blueprint submission. These eight teams will then

race their Cordless Karts on a specially designed race track at the Open Car Park Space on

Jalan Binjai, near KLCC, on 30 July 2011.

2. Dimensions, Mass, Design

a. There are no restrictions to the mass of the vehicle.

b. Dimensions: At the determination of dimensions the conditions of delivery to the spot shall

be taken into account (Width: max. 130 cm).

c. The distance between the driver’s foot and the vehicle's front shall be at least 300 mm.

d. The seat shall be placed in such manner that there should be the largest safety distance

possible provided between the seat and the sides of the vehicle.

e. A roll bar shall be installed, which shall rise above the driver’s crash-helmet by a min. of

100 mm.

f. The driver’s seat shall provide for the proper side support of the driver. In the line of the

shoulders and the thighs the seat shall rise from the plane of the seat by min. 100 mm.

Racing bucket seats are allowed to be used.

g. The vehicle shall proceed on two or three tracks, and it shall have three or four wheels.

h. The vehicle should have a minimum ground clearance of 70mm with driver on board.

3. Safety

a. A safety belt with at least two-point belt installation shall be used, the installation points

shall be marked on the kinetic diagram.

b. Use of crash-helmets with chin protection shall be compulsory.

c. Closed clothing (of cotton) fully covering hands and feet shall also be compulsory. Race

suits may also be used.

d. The source of power (battery packs) (in addition to the original 4 pcs of power tools) shall

be fixed in a safe manner, and the vehicle shall be equipped with a circuit breaker switch.

e. The vehicle shall have a side brace that protects the driver from injuries in case of possible

collisions.

f. The leg space of the vehicle shall not be open in a downward direction (in order to avoid

foot injuries).

g. The construction of the vehicle should not have any sharp and / or extension parts that

would represent a hazard to the driver or the other competitors in case of a possible

collision.

h. The vehicle shall be constructed in such way that the height of the seat’s seating surface

may not exceed 50% of the vehicle’s width.

4. Framework, Vehicle Body

a. The chassis of the vehicle shall be made in accordance with Section 2.a, carrying the self-

made driving devices (machinery), the whole driving chain and the driven wheel(s).

b. The vehicle does not need to be equipped with a closed body-work, but the moving parts of

the drive shall be covered by protective casing for safety purposes.

5. Motor

a. The drive shall be resolved by the use of the provided power tools.

b. The provided power tools may not be modified for the purpose of it to be used, it cannot

be disassembled (it must not lose its original function as a drill / driver).

Page 9: Bosch Power Tools Asia Cordless Race 2011 - External Project Brief (Updated)

Page 9 of 40

c. For the drive of the vehicle only the individual batteries of the 4 pieces of provided power

tools may be used (modification not allowed).

d. For the drive all 4 power tools provided shall be utilised.

e. The individual batteries of the power tools used may be utilised in the course of the

preparation process. For the whole period of the competition the batteries of required

quantities and charge-up shall be provided to the teams by the organizer.

f. The 4 power tools shall be provided to the teams by the organizer following their successful

selection as one of the 8 shortlisted teams.

6. Drive Chain

a. The application of free-wheel is mandatory.

7. Steering Gear

a. The vehicle shall be easy to steer, the driver shall be able to drive easily straight and take

a bend, by normal force applied.

b. The vehicle should be able to turn around on a 10 m wide race track (turning circle).

8. Brake

a. The vehicle shall be equipped with two independent brakes, capable, in case of a moving

vehicle, to provide for efficient reduction of speed and to stop the vehicle (it should be

able to stop from a specified speed after a specified distance).

b. One of the brakes shall be able to safely fix the vehicle in stationary position.

9. Documentation

a. Structural draft design: The competing teams shall be obliged to prepare the draft design

of the vehicle, which shall include the configuration of the drive, the steering gear, the

suspension and the framework structure (key dimensions, base materials, design of drive

chain, scaled technical drawing).

b. Detailed assembly drawing: The shortlisted/ competing teams shall be obliged to prepare

the assembly drawing of the vehicle to be designed, which shall include the configuration

of the drive, the steering gear, the suspension, the framework structure, brake structure,

seat and safety belt (key dimensions, base materials, design of drive chain, scaled technical

drawing – not final design).

3.3 GENERAL RULES & REGULATIONS FOR RACE DAY

Start waiting area / Maintenance area

The start waiting area is the place where the vehicles are located on the day of the race,

and where maintenance and repair work may be performed on the vehicles (example as

below):

Only the following persons shall be allowed to have access to the start waiting area:

- Registered team members (whose names are listed on the application sheets);

- The staff of the organiser, who have been assigned to supervise that area

Within the space of the start waiting area the teams shall be allowed to perform any repair

works that are in compliance with the Invitation to Competition on their vehicles, with own

tools or tools and equipment provided by the organiser. These works may not be dangerous

to the physical integrity of persons or assets, and they shall be in compliance with effective

local legislation and laws. The teams shall bear full responsibility for the observation

thereof

No team shall be allowed to dissemble or modify the battery packs in the start waiting /

maintenance area. Contact the staff of the organizer in case of needing power supply

Non-compliance with the above mentioned rules shall entail sanctions ranging from time

penalty to exclusion

The race:

- The quantity of batteries required for the lap race shall be provided by the

organizer. These shall be handed to the teams right before the start of the race

- During the race, deliberate collisions shall entail sanctions, ranging from time

penalty to exclusion

- In the course of the heats each team shall leave the race to enter the waiting /

maintenance area for battery replacement / charging. The competitor may check

the level of battery load prior to exchange by way of immediate measurement

provided by the organizer

- During the heat, following the start, the driver shall be allowed to get out of the

car only in the waiting / maintenance area, and / or in the safety zones of the track

isolated from race traffic. Should the vehicle become immobilized, the driver shall

wait for the technical rescue personnel, who shall push the vehicle into the safety

zone assigned by the organiser. The team members shall be allowed to push the

vehicle into their own waiting / maintenance only upon permission and signal of the

staffs of the organizer

- Once the immobilized vehicle has been pushed into the maintenance area, the

competitor shall be entitled to re-enter the race after repair or replacement of the

battery

- During the heats repair work may be performed on the vehicles in the waiting /

maintenance area, and the competitor himself may perform repair work in the

above mentioned designated areas, with the tools at his disposal

- Those teams failing to avoid the obstacle in the race track shall be imposed a time

penalty

- Teams shall also be imposed a time penalty for missing each obstacle

- During the heats the competitors shall observe the following flag signals with regard

to the race:

o 1 yellow flag waved: danger, you must be prepared to avoid an obstacle

located on the track. During the effect of this sign it is prohibited to

Page 16: Bosch Power Tools Asia Cordless Race 2011 - External Project Brief (Updated)

Page 16 of 40

overtake another vehicle. Disregard of the rule shall entail sanctions,

ranging from time penalty to exclusion

o 2 yellow flags waved: obstacle on the track, be prepared to stop. During

the effect of this sign it is prohibited to overtake another vehicle.

Disregard of the rule shall entail sanctions, ranging from time penalty to

exclusion

o Green flag: releases the effect of the yellow flag. Dangerous zone over

o Red flag: race interrupted, slow down immediately and return to waiting

/ maintenance area

o Blue flag: there is a faster vehicle approaching, you must let the vehicle

proceeding behind you pass as soon as possible and in a safe manner.

This shall not apply to cars within the same lap, only the vehicles lapped

shall take this signal into account

o Checked flag: indicates the end of the heat, the competitors shall leave

for the place designated by the organiser

Finish:

- The finish is flying finish

- Time shall be measured by the organizer

- The timekeeping system shall register the passing through the finish line of the

initial point of the vehicle

- After the race is flagged down, the driver must immediately operate the brakes and

drive back to individual maintenance area

- Team leader shall sign on the result confirmation sheet after each round for

competition

- It is obligatory for each team to return to their maintenance area for battery

replacement after each round

- Each team shall obey the referees in any conditions and in case of any

disagreement, report to the staff of the organizer

3.6 F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S

Driving Innovation - Bosch Power Tools Asia Cordless Race 2011 - Frequently Asked

Questions (FAQs)

1. What is the mode of the competition?

In the competition the team should design a vehicle with the drive system being powered

by the Bosch power tools provided by the organizer based on the given design

requirements. The selected vehicles will enter into a lap race competition, with winners

finishing the race with the fastest time (rules and regulations of the competition apply). 2

winner(s) of each of the qualifying race in the countries will be entitled to enter the final

race in China in Q3.2011.

2. Are there any restrictions for the material of car case / frame?

There are no restrictions for the material used.

3. Are there restrictions for the design of the drive system? What type of requirement are

prescribed?

The drive system can be designed freely. The only restriction is that all 4 Bosch power tools

provided must be utilised as a part of the karts design and during the race itself.

4. Is there a weight limit involved?

There is no weight limit.

5. Is it possible to build a vehicle with 6 wheels?

6 wheels will not be allowed. The design may be made with either a 3 or 4 wheel

configuration.

6. How can Bosch Power Tools ensure that all the baterries will be equally charged?

During the race, the charging level of the batteries will be measured.

7. How are the power tools connected to the drive chain?

The power tools can be attached with any solution. However,changes or modifications to

the power toosl themselves are not permitted.

8. Is it possible to charge back energy during the race?

Re-charging of batteries via electrical methods are not permitted as they entail the

modification of the tools themselves. However, energy saving methods which involve

mechanical modifications (e.g. installation of a fly-wheel) will be allowed.

9. Is it allowed to change batteries during the race?

During the race the batteries can be changed at the waiting / maintenance and or pit stop

(optional).

10. Is there a specific format for the blueprint?

There is no specific format for the blueprint but AutoCad is preferred.

11. What are the requirements for the blueprint? What should it cover exactly and how

detailed should it be?

The minimum requirement for the blueprint should at least cover the kart’s external

design (which will detail all necessary safety requirements) as well as the engine

and gear design (This should detail the methods used by the competitor to connect Bosch

Power tools to the drive shaft).

12. Are participants required to submit any supporting materials in writing for the

blueprint?

Yes, each team is required to provide supporting documents in writing as an explanation to

their blueprint. Competitors are also encouraged to provide calculated parameters of the

kart’s design (e.g. expected maximum speed, duration of running time on single battery

charge etc) if possible.

13. Who will own the copyright of the blueprint in the event the team is not shortlisted?

Teams that are not shortlisted will be allowed to retain all copyrights to their original

blueprint. However, given advance notice from Bosch, shortlisted teams will be obliged to

hand over their completed karts which may or may not be used by Bosch for other activities

(as will be stated in the agreement between Bosch and shortlisted teams)

14. Can the racing-karts be solar powered?

No, the racing-karts cannot be solar powered. All karts must utilize the Ion-lithium power

source of the Bosch Cordless Power tools provided.

15. Can additional batteries be added to the racing-karts?

No, additional batteries cannot be added to the racing-karts.

16. What is the distance of the race track?

150m.

17. Will Bosch bear all expenses of the winning team and shipment of the racing-kart to the

Grand Finals in Beijing?

Yes.

4.2 SPECIFICATION TABLE

GSB 18V-LI PROFESSIONAL 2.6 Ah

Battery voltage [V] 18

Battery capacity [Ah] 2.6 or 3.0

Cell technology Li-ion

Charging time [min] : AL1860CV / 1820CV Ca. 30 / 75

Tool length [mm] 195

Tool height [mm] 248

Weight including battery [kg] 1.9

Chuck capacity, max [mm] 13

Impact rate [BPM] 0 – 25, 500

No. load speed [RPM] : 1st / 2nd gear 0 – 500 / 1,700

Max. torque [Nm] : Hard / Soft Joint 67 / 28

Max. drilling diameter [mm]

Wood 35

Steel 13

Masonry 13

Max. screwing diameter [mm] 8

Clutch settings 18 + 1

LED light Yes

4.3 THE MOTOR

New open-frame motor with 4-poles

It’s small in size, light in weight yet powerful

Magnetic force is applied to the whole rotor circumference

Combines rare earth magnets (strongest type of permanent magnets available) in a 4-pole

motor

Hence, results in a powerful high torque, efficient motor design

Page 26: Bosch Power Tools Asia Cordless Race 2011 - External Project Brief (Updated)

Page 26 of 40

4.4 ELECTRONIC MOTOR PROTECTION

The Electronic Motor Protection (EMP) protects the motor from overload

It continuously controls the discharge current, temperature of the battery pack and

discharge status

The limits for these parameters are defined in such a way that the motor is protected from

damage

Depending on the measured values, an intelligent algorithm controls the motor

performance

As soon as the EMP recognizes an overload that could damage the batteries of the motor, it

shuts down the tool

4.5 BOSCH PREMIUM LI-ION TECHNOLOGY

Benefits of Li-ion Battery

More power at the same weight

- Compared to Ni-technology batteries, therefore tools can get smaller and lighter

No memory effect

- Battery does not need to be empty before charging. It can be taken out of the

charger before the charging process is completed

Significantly less self-discharge

- A battery that is not used for long periods of time do not need to be charged prior

to use again

No loss of power

- Full battery power from the first to the last screw or hole

Page 28: Bosch Power Tools Asia Cordless Race 2011 - External Project Brief (Updated)

Page 28 of 40

4.6 ELECTRIC CELL PROTECTION

The Electric Cell Protection (ECP), protects the Li-ion battery from 3 dangers:

Deep Discharge

- Reduction of current flow if voltage level is at its end

Overheating

- Decreasing of the current flow if the tool or the battery is too hot

Overload

- Reducing currently flow if the current draw is too high
